Wheaton is a suburban city located in DuPage County, Illinois, approximately 25 miles west of Chicago. Founded in the mid-19th century, the city has grown into a significant cultural and educational center in the western suburbs of Chicago.
The city is home to Wheaton College, a private liberal arts institution established in 1860, which significantly influences the local cultural landscape. The historic downtown area features well-preserved architecture and hosts various cultural events throughout the year. Wheaton maintains several parks and natural areas, reflecting the city's commitment to preserving green spaces while fostering community engagement.
The city's cultural scene is enhanced by its proximity to Chicago, allowing residents and visitors access to both local amenities and major metropolitan cultural offerings.
